Tarvitz Car Clio 172 2001 Jul 7, 2020 #1 Hi all, does anyone know if you can get the plastic clips that help attach the rear bumper to the car anywhere? My driver side one broke off when removing the bumper, Thanks
Hi all, does anyone know if you can get the plastic clips that help attach the rear bumper to the car anywhere? My driver side one broke off when removing the bumper, Thanks